[svn-r5273]

Purpose:
    New feature
Description:
    Allow H5Glink and H5Gmove to handle links across different locations.
Solution:
    Added H5Glink2 and H5Gmove2 functions with new parameter of destination
    location.
Platforms tested:
    Linux 2.2(eirene)

New Features
============
* New functions H5Glink2 and H5Gmove2 were added to allow link and move to
be in different locations in the same file. The old functions H5Glink
and H5Gmove remain valid. SLU - 2002/04/26
* Fill-value's behaviors for contiguous dataset have been redefined.
Basicly, dataset won't allocate space until it's necessary. Full details
are available at http://hdf.ncsa.uiuc.edu/RFC/Fill_Value, at this moment.
